Description Brent Fulgham 2013-05-15 11:10:49 PDT
Many of the utilities used for Windows building are based around Windows XP-era SDK's and VS2005 paths.  While many of the build solutions were updated for VS2010, the various command-line tools used by testing bots or other automated environments were not updated to reflect the new tool chain.

This bug makes the following changes:

1. Teach 'webkitdirs.pm' about various acceptable Windows SDK's that users might standardize on to build WebKit.
2. Update 'build-api-tests' to select the correct Visual Studio solution based on the current build environment.
3. Update 'build-dumprendertree' to select the correct Visual Studio solution based on the current build environment.
4. Update 'build-webkit' to select the correct Visual Studio solution based on the current build environment.

Note: The JSC solution needs to also be updated to build as a stand-alone solution.  Once that is done, we can update 'build-jsc' to recognize the VS2010 (or newer) environment.
